Abstract
The invention discloses a structure-improved tire ring belt machine suction plate, which comprises a bracket, a belt fixation plate and a long strip reinforcing plate with a length of more than a bracket length, wherein the reinforcing plate is fixedly connected with the belt fixation plate, and the bracket is fixedly arranged on one reinforcing plate side backward facing the belt fixation plate. According to the present invention, the long strip reinforcing plate is arranged between the bracket and the belt fixation plate, tension force of the bracket directly acts on the reinforcing plate, the large tension force is decomposed into a lot of small tension force with the reinforcing plate, and then the lot of the small tension force act on the belt fixation plate, such that stress concentration on the belt fixation plate is reduced, frequent fracture of the belt fixation plate due to stress concentration is effectively avoided, a service life of the belt fixation plate is prolonged, the belt fixation plate is not required to be frequently replaced, processing cost is reduced, and processing efficiency is increased.
Description
Technical field
The present invention relates to a kind of tire endless belt machine suction disc, particularly a kind of structure improved tire endless belt machine suction disc.
Background technology
The structure of existing tire endless belt machine suction disc is that support is directly fixed on the belt fixed head by four screws, the belt fixed head in use causes and the damage of breaking of screw link position because of stressed concentrate easily, cause the frequent belt fixed head of changing of needs, lose time, also cause processing cost constantly to raise.
Summary of the invention
In order to remedy above deficiency, the invention provides a kind of structure improved tire endless belt machine suction disc, this structure improved tire endless belt machine suction disc has reduced stress to be concentrated, and has prolonged the service life of belt fixed head, has reduced processing cost.
The present invention for the technical scheme that solves its technical problem and adopt is: a kind of structure improved tire endless belt machine suction disc, comprise support, the belt fixed head, also be provided with a length and be longer than the strip gusset plate of stent length, this gusset plate is fixedlyed connected with the belt fixed head, support is fixedly arranged on a gusset plate side of belt fixed head dorsad, the pulling force of support directly acts on gusset plate, gusset plate remakes for the belt fixed head, because gusset plate is longer, big pulling force is resolved into some little pulling force, the stress that has reduced on the belt reinforcement plate is concentrated, and has effectively avoided belt fixed head stress to concentrate the phenomenon of the frequent fracture that causes to take place.
As a further improvement on the present invention, all adopt screw to be connected between employing and gusset plate and the belt fixed head between described support and the gusset plate, tie point between gusset plate and the belt fixed head is arranged along belt fixed head length direction, some tie points are distributed in support along the both sides of belt reinforcement plate length direction, can certainly be rivet syndeton or welding connection structure.
Useful technique effect of the present invention is: the present invention will arrange the gusset plate of strip between support and the belt fixed head, the pulling force of support directly acts on gusset plate, gusset plate resolves into some little pulling force with big pulling force and remakes for the belt fixed head, the stress that has reduced on the belt reinforcement plate is concentrated, effectively avoided belt fixed head stress to concentrate the phenomenon of the frequent fracture that causes to take place, prolonged the service life of belt fixed head, need not frequently to change the belt fixed head, reduce processing cost, improved working (machining) efficiency.
